javascript中绑定body的onload事件的几种方法?

JavaScript016

javascript中绑定body的onload事件的几种方法?,第1张

一般来说,有4种方法:

1:直接把代码写在html里,例如:<body onload="functionA()functionB()">

2:写在页面的js里,例如:

window.onload = function () {

functionA()

functionB()

}

3:用绑定事件的方式绑定上去,例如:

function addListener (element, event, fn) {

if (window.attachEvent) {

element.attachEvent('on' + event, fn)

} else {

element.addEventListener(event, fn, false)

}

}

addListener(window, 'load', functionA)

addListener(window, 'load', functionB)

4:用第三方js框架(如jquery)来绑定事件,例如:

$("body").on("load",function(){

})

1、首先创建一个名称为onload的html文件,如下图所示。

2、设置标题为 javascript  onload,如下图所示。

3、在body标签 中加入onload事件,并在事件中加入自定义函数 myonload。

4、在文档区域加入一个h 元素,加入文本内容“页面加载完成显示页面内容”,当页面加载完成 后 显示该内容。

5、创建一个自定义函数myload,当页面完成后,调用该自定义函数,并加入alert提示语。

6、在浏览器中打开该文件,首先会弹出页面加载完成后调用的myonload函数,在现实页面内容。